Abstract
A novel cationic starch derivative was prepared by esterifying native potato starch with anhydrous betaine. The reaction was performed on native potato starch using betainyl chloride in refluxing 1,4-dioxane with pyridine as a nucleophilic catalyst. The product was characterized spectrometrically and its molecular weight distribution was determined. Additionally, the applicability of starch betainate for paper manufacturing was studied. The product is considered to be environmentally more friendly than the traditional cationic starch ethers currently in commercial use as it consists solely of natural and biodegradable products.
